Cryptic Rooms
A series of 3 VR escape rooms, Eye Eaters Basement, Dungeon of Demise, and Inescapable Hypercube. You must navigate through and solve puzzles, each room with its own unique theme and hidden relics that can be found and collected.

About Cryptic Rooms
Cryptic Rooms is a Strategy game developed by QTArts. On 4/17/2020, it was released on the Steam Store by QTArts.
It can be played and ran on Windows systems. At the moment, there is no confirmed information regarding Steam Deck support for this game.
